Job description
Overview

Our client, a well-established private company in the automotive industry with $450M in revenue, is seeking a dynamic Key Accounts Manager to join their growing team. This role is critical to driving revenue growth and maintaining strong relationships with their key clients. You\'ll serve as the dedicated point of contact for their most important accounts while identifying new business opportunities in the automotive market.

In this position, you\'ll manage the full sales cycle (12-24 months), represent the company at trade fairs and industry events, and work closely with the Sales Director to expand market presence. The role offers excellent autonomy, high visibility within the organization, and the opportunity to build long-term strategic partnerships.

Responsibilities
  • Acquire and develop new customers in the automotive market
  • Manage and strengthen existing key client relationships
  • Analyze client needs and develop tailored solutions
  • Coordinate sales activities and implement control processes
  • Track and manage customer change requests (CR/ICR processes)
  • Represent the company at industry trade fairs and events
Essential
  • Proven sales track record in the automotive industry with an established network
  • Fluent English proficiency
  • Relevant sales experience and education
  • Strong customer relationship management skills
  • Excellent coordination and communication abilities
  • Strong organizational skills and follow-through capabilities
  • Experience with change request processes and client support
Preferred
  • Polish language skills or cultural familiarity
  • Experience with automotive suppliers (Bosch, Continental, Aptiv, etc.)
  • Trade fair and industry event experience

Salary: $110,000 - $113,000 annually

Bonus: 15% annual performance bonus

Benefits: Comprehensive healthcare, 401K, and retirement plan

Time Off: 20 vacation days + 5 sick days annually

Travel: Minimal travel required (<25%), all expenses covered by company

Additional Information
  • Location: Sylvan Lake, Michigan (Onsite)
  • Timeline: Immediate start preferred (30-60 day hiring process)
  • Reporting: Direct report to Sales Director
  • Company: Established private company with $450M revenue and strong growth trajectory
